In Kazakhstan, the construction of more than 1,600 kilometers of cement concrete roads in various regions over the past 15 years has made a significant contribution to improving the country's transport infrastructure. This development is driven by the strategic importance of transport corridors and the increasing intensity of truck traffic, which requires improved transport efficiency, safety and environmental sustainability. The modernization of road infrastructure not only increases the efficiency of vehicles and the speed of cargo delivery, but also plays a crucial role in sustainable economic development, attracting investment, expanding trade and increasing the competitiveness of regional economies. This article examines the importance of cement concrete roads in the transport network of Kazakhstan and their role in achieving these goals. In particular, it emphasizes the need to use high-quality building materials, including modified concretes with improved performance, for road construction projects. In addition, the article discusses modern high-strength concrete mixtures and their composition, emphasizes the importance of accurate dosing to achieve the desired technical characteristics and properties. Overall, this study highlights the crucial role of cement concrete roads in the development of Kazakhstan's transport infrastructure, promoting economic growth and mitigating environmental impacts through efficiency and sustainability measures.
